Heigh-Ho is a song from the animated 1937 Disney film Snow White and the Seven Dwarfs sung by the Dwarf Chorus in a mine.

The two other songs are Bluddle-Uddle-Um-Dum and The Silly Song sung by the Dwarf Septet.

In the movie Gremlins, the title creatures watched Snow White and the Seven Dwarfs at a movie theater and sang Heigh-Ho over and over.
